Iranian, Russian Presidents Confer on Syria, N. Deal

TEHRAN (Tasnim) – Iranian President Hassan Rouhani and his Russian counterpart Vladimir Putin had a telephone conversation on Thursday, the Kremlin press service reported.

Putin and Rouhani discussed aspects of the development of mutually beneficial bilateral cooperation in various fields and relevant international problems.

Their talks include the situation in Syria in the context of preparations for the Geneva II International Peace Conference on Syria and the implementation of the agreements that have been reached on the Iranian nuclear program, Voice of Russia reported.
